Форум программистов, компьютерный форум CyberForum.ru

Необходимо найти сумму элементов, которые принадлежат промежутку от a до b (не включая границы) -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Требуется определить, является ли сумма квадратов всех его элементов пятизначным числом http://www.cyberforum.ru/cpp-beginners/thread1678376.html
Дан массив a из n целых чисел. Требуется определить, является ли сумма квадратов всех его элементов пятизначным числом.
C++ Необходимо найти максимальное и минимальное значение элементов массива Дан массив из n элементов. Необходимо найти максимальное и минимальное значение элементов массива. http://www.cyberforum.ru/cpp-beginners/thread1678374.html
C++ Класс для работы со СЛАУ
Помогите, как можно реализовать класс для работы со СЛАУ в C++? Совершенно не представляю, как это можно и нужно сделать
как в программе C++Builder XE3 и Dev-C++ писать на русском? C++
как в программе C++Builder XE3 и Dev-C++ писать на русском?
C++ Вычислить среднее значение элементов матрицы, находящихся над главной диагональю http://www.cyberforum.ru/cpp-beginners/thread1678344.html
Помогте пліз_____ На выбор второй опции меню вычислить среднее значение элементов матрицы, находящихся над главной диагональю, и произведение элементов под главной диагональю, значение которых лежит в диапазоне -1<= x <=1. Найти в каждой строке матрицы максимальный и минимальный элемент и поместить их на место первого и последнего элемента строки соответственно. Результаты расчетов и содержание...
C++ Программа для обработки матриц Составить на одном из алгоритмических языков программу, запускается и выдает на экран меню из четырех пунктов (генерация, обработка, выход). На выбор первой опции меню с использованием встроенных в язык подпрограмм заполнить матрицу А размерностью m =m псевдослучайными действительными числами в диапазоне -5.3 ---17.23 и вывести ее содержание в виде, удобном для восприятия. Принять m = 8. На... подробнее

Показать сообщение отдельно
GbaLog-
Не Эксперт C++
1428 / 614 / 172
Регистрация: 24.08.2014
Сообщений: 2,486
Записей в блоге: 1
Завершенные тесты: 2
06.03.2016, 12:05     Необходимо найти сумму элементов, которые принадлежат промежутку от a до b (не включая границы)
llord,
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
///////////////////////////////////////////////////////////
// Задача: Дан массив из nn элементов и числа a и b. 
// Необходимо найти сумму элементов, которые принадлежат промежутку от a до b 
// (не включая границы).
///////////////////////////////////////////////////////////
#include <iostream>
#include <vector>
#include <algorithm>
#include <iterator>
///////////////////////////////////////////////////////////
int main()
{
    int a,b,sum = 0;
    const int n = 10;
    std::vector<int> vec(n);
    std::copy_n(std::istream_iterator<int>(std::cin),n,vec.begin());
    std::cin >> a >> b;
    for(int i = a + 1; i < b; ++i)
        sum += vec[i];
    std::cout << sum << std::endl;
}
 
Текущее время: 05:49.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ru